Billing Administrator - Utility Distribution, Fulltime Oakville Hydro delivers reliable and safe electricity to more than 77,000 individuals, families, and businesses in the Town of Oakville. The company maintains an active commitment to conservation, safety, and is strongly invested in the social and economic well‑being of the Oakville community. Oakville Hydro is a two‑time recipient of the Local Distribution Company Performance Excellence Award from the Electricity Distributors Association, as well as a Centre of Excellence Award from the Canadian Electricity Association. Oakville Hydro has also been recognized as one of Canada’s Safest Employers. At Oakville Hydro, we believe that our continued success as an industry leader is due to our innovative, customer‑focused, team‑oriented employees who continually strive to exceed customer expectations and take pride in all areas of our businesses. About the Role We are looking for dynamic individuals with exceptional customer service and technical skills. The Billing Administrator is accountable for supporting the Customer Service and Billing departmental functions, including answering customer inquiries, collecting data for billing purposes, and producing timely and accurate customer bills. Duties Include Respond to customer inquiries and complaints in person, by phone, and in writing Receive, interpret, and summarize customers’ requests (including lawyers) to finalize existing billings Review and process customer forms and requests Initiate process adjustments to customer accounts Complete Validation, Estimation, and Editing (VEE) of meter read data and reports (electric and water) in preparation for billing Update electric and water readings in Northstar, as required Verify, change, and enter water meter information into the Northstar system Process regular on‑cycle billing and final billing Process customer payments Administer permits, and schedule disconnections and reconnections Administer the collection process for overdue accounts Communicate with stakeholders to ensure timely and accurate processing of customer meter‑to‑cash transactions Other duties as assigned by supervisor Required Skills, Qualifications and Experience Grade 12 high school or equivalent Minimum of 2 years’ experience in a Billing and/or Customer Service environment Experience with billing procedures, schedules, and adjustments would be an asset Intermediate working knowledge of personal computers including Windows‑based software such as Outlook, Microsoft Teams, Excel, Access, PowerPoint, etc. Working knowledge of customer information systems (e.g., Northstar) would be an asset Strong accounting skills Working knowledge of billing and adjustment procedures Solid understanding of reading and billing schedule Strong decision‑making and problem‑solving skills related to electricity and water consumption to produce accurate billing Excellent written and verbal communication skills Excellent time management and organization skills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to use tact and discretion when interacting with internal and external customers Displays a keen attention to detail and can prioritize accordingly in a demanding and fast‑paced environment Embraces a culture of innovation and continuous improvement Is a fast learner who can adapt to an ever‑changing environment Is agile, responsive, and displays a sense of urgency Other Success Factors Be a brand ambassador – enable, engage, encourage, and exemplify the behaviours and attitudes of the brand Stay a step ahead – be in‑tune with key industry disruptions, such as electrification of transportation, grid modernization, and Smart Grid Communicate – stay informed of company events, industry news, and advancement in technologies Is customer‑centric and displays an attitude of commitment and excellence with service delivery Have a futuristic and proactive mindset with the ability to foresee problems and act as required Be a creative thinker with strong planning, organization, and execution skills Have strong planning and problem‑solving skills with the proven ability to identify, analyse and correct unusual occurrences within systems and consider all relevant information when making a decision Displays keen attention to detail and prioritise accordingly in a demanding, fast‑paced environment Is a fast learner who can adapt to an ever‑changing environment Excellent interpersonal and communication skills Embraces a culture of innovation and continuous improvement Oakville Hydro is an Equal Opportunity Employer.
